Co-production – principles
facilitation not delivery
valuing participants
building on their strengths
developing peer-support networks
mutuality and reciprocity

To create a Welsh vision of co-production that builds on our
traditions of mutualism and co-operation.
To move to a values-based approach to service
commissioning, design, delivery & evaluation.
To improve the effectiveness of service delivery.
To increase collaboration and partnership across agencies,
sectors and communities.
To increase citizen engagement in service delivery.
To revitalise communities and empower individuals.
To respond effectively to major public sector cuts.
